package java.awt.image;

import org.apache.harmony.awt.internal.nls.Messages;

/**
 * The MultiPixelPackedSampleModel class represents image data with one band.
 * This class packs multiple pixels with one sample in one data element and
 * supports the following data types: DataBuffer.TYPE_BYTE,
 * DataBuffer.TYPE_USHORT, or DataBuffer.TYPE_INT.
 * 
 * @since Android 1.0
 */
public class MultiPixelPackedSampleModel extends SampleModel {

    /**
     * The pixel bit stride.
     */
    private int pixelBitStride;

    /**
     * The scanline stride.
     */
    private int scanlineStride;

    /**
     * The data bit offset.
     */
    private int dataBitOffset;

    /**
     * The bit mask.
     */
    private int bitMask;

    /**
     * The data element size.
     */
    private int dataElementSize;

    /**
     * The pixels per data element.
     */
    private int pixelsPerDataElement;

    /**
     * Instantiates a new MultiPixelPackedSampleModel with the specified
     * parameters.
     * 
     * @param dataType
     *            the data type of the samples.
     * @param w
     *            the width of the image data.
     * @param h
     *            the height of the image data.
     * @param numberOfBits
     *            the number of bits per pixel.
     * @param scanlineStride
     *            the scanline stride of the of the image data.
     * @param dataBitOffset
     *            the array of the band offsets.
     */
    public MultiPixelPackedSampleModel(int dataType, int w, int h, int numberOfBits,
            int scanlineStride, int dataBitOffset) {

        super(dataType, w, h, 1);
        if (dataType != DataBuffer.TYPE_BYTE && dataType != DataBuffer.TYPE_USHORT
                && dataType != DataBuffer.TYPE_INT) {
            // awt.61=Unsupported data type: {0}
            throw new IllegalArgumentException(Messages.getString("awt.61", //$NON-NLS-1$
                    dataType));
        }

        this.scanlineStride = scanlineStride;
        if (numberOfBits == 0) {
            // awt.20C=Number of Bits equals to zero
            throw new RasterFormatException(Messages.getString("awt.20C")); //$NON-NLS-1$
        }
        this.pixelBitStride = numberOfBits;
        this.dataElementSize = DataBuffer.getDataTypeSize(dataType);
        if (dataElementSize % pixelBitStride != 0) {
            // awt.20D=The number of bits per pixel is not a power of 2 or
            // pixels span data element boundaries
            throw new RasterFormatException(Messages.getString("awt.20D")); //$NON-NLS-1$
        }

        if (dataBitOffset % numberOfBits != 0) {
            // awt.20E=Data Bit offset is not a multiple of pixel bit stride
            throw new RasterFormatException(Messages.getString("awt.20E")); //$NON-NLS-1$
        }
        this.dataBitOffset = dataBitOffset;

        this.pixelsPerDataElement = dataElementSize / pixelBitStride;
        this.bitMask = (1 << numberOfBits) - 1;
    }

    @Override
    public int getSample(int x, int y, int b, DataBuffer data) {
        if (x < 0 || y < 0 || x >= this.width || y >= this.height || b != 0) {
            // awt.63=Coordinates are not in bounds
            throw new ArrayIndexOutOfBoundsException(Messages.getString("awt.63")); //$NON-NLS-1$
        }

        int bitnum = dataBitOffset + x * pixelBitStride;
        int elem = data.getElem(y * scanlineStride + bitnum / dataElementSize);
        int shift = dataElementSize - (bitnum & (dataElementSize - 1)) - pixelBitStride;

        return (elem >> shift) & bitMask;
    }

    private void setSample(final int x, final int y, final Object obj, final DataBuffer data,
            final int methodId, int s) {
        if ((x < 0) || (y < 0) || (x >= this.width) || (y >= this.height)) {
            // awt.63=Coordinates are not in bounds
            throw new ArrayIndexOutOfBoundsException(Messages.getString("awt.63")); //$NON-NLS-1$
        }

        final int bitnum = dataBitOffset + x * pixelBitStride;
        final int idx = y * scanlineStride + bitnum / dataElementSize;
        final int shift = dataElementSize - (bitnum & (dataElementSize - 1)) - pixelBitStride;
        final int mask = ~(bitMask << shift);
        int elem = data.getElem(idx);

        switch (methodId) {
            case 1: { // Invoked from setDataElements()
                switch (getTransferType()) {
                    case DataBuffer.TYPE_BYTE:
                        s = ((byte[])obj)[0] & 0xff;
                        break;
                    case DataBuffer.TYPE_USHORT:
                        s = ((short[])obj)[0] & 0xffff;
                        break;
                    case DataBuffer.TYPE_INT:
                        s = ((int[])obj)[0];
                        break;
                }
                break;
            }
            case 2: { // Invoked from setPixel()
                s = ((int[])obj)[0];
                break;
            }
        }

        elem &= mask;
        elem |= (s & bitMask) << shift;
        data.setElem(idx, elem);
    }
